I have always struggled with setting goals. And I seldom achieved them.  

I would start out being excited and fired up, and then gradually I would lose interest and start being bored.
Then life told me to grow up by smacking me really hard.

It was a time that nothing in my life was working. I was broke, with no job and no prospects. I’ve lost my motivation and I wasn’t inspired about life. With the little fighting spirit that was still left inside of me, I looked at my life and searched for the one thing I could do to get out of the hole I was in.

I wanted it to be simple. You don't need complicated solutions when you are looking for a way out.


My one thing needed to have the following requirements:

  •  It must inspire me enough to get out of bed, and to just feel alive again. 

  • It needed to be simple but effective.

  • It had to be challenging and rewarding.
  • I and I alone must be held accountable to it.

  • It was important that it made me happy and woke me up to the possibilities life has to offer. 

  • It mustn't cost a cent

I just wanted to remember that life can beautiful again, and that I can achieve things again. I wanted to hope again. Plus, I was tired of feeling sorry for myself.

I did find that one thing. I discovered running. It was simple. All I had to do was to wake up before everyone else and hit the road.

Doing this one thing changed my life in countless ways:

  •  I became more disciplined and focused - I started completing everything I started and    realised the importance of discipline.

  • I developed a can-do attitude - Instead of complaining I started asking what can be done.

  • I no longer saw obstacles - Instead of focusing on problems I started looking for solutions

  • I became more resilient - I stopped being a quitter and no longer gave up when things became difficult

  • I became more positive and started dreaming again - Having a reason to get out of bed in the morning without anyone telling me to do so, but doing it for myself empowered me in ways I didn’t expect at all. I was happy again.


                                              

I lost the weight and the centimeters as a bonus. I did become happier and much calmer as well. Just by focusing one goal that really mattered I was rewarded with so much more.
